Output 6526863358d32ab8bb8f2d2959d131f3ebcfb73366a07f8e0b6bd6f2af6c5212:0

value
7700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b48d4c62f2fef198efcba735d77eed4162a48c41 OP_EQUALVERIFY OP_CHECKSIG
address
1HTfu7aNXjsveZoSQ2phxa7UAifaRhdRTX
transaction
6526863358d32ab8bb8f2d2959d131f3ebcfb73366a07f8e0b6bd6f2af6c5212
confirmations
249759
spent
true